Calathea orbifolia
Calathea orbifolia is a striking indoor plant known for its large, round leaves feature prominent silver-gray stripes that contrast beautifully against the dark green background, giving the plant a stunning visual appeal.
-
Light: Calathea orbifolia prefers bright, indirect light. Avoid exposing it to direct sunlight, as this can cause the leaves to fade or develop scorched patches. Place it near a window with filtered sunlight or in a location where it can receive bright, indirect light throughout the day. In low light conditions, consider supplementing with artificial grow lights.
-
Watering: Keep the soil evenly moist, but not waterlogged. Water the plant when the top inch of the soil feels dry to the touch, typically every 1-2 weeks depending on environmental conditions. Use room temperature water to avoid shocking the roots. Ensure that the pot has proper drainage to prevent waterlogging, which can lead to root rot.
-
Pruning: Remove any yellowing, damaged, or dead leaves regularly to maintain the plant's appearance and overall health. You can also trim back leggy stems to encourage bushier growth.
-
Fertilization: Feed Calathea orbifolia with a balanced liquid fertilizer diluted to half strength every 4-6 weeks during the growing season (spring and summer). Reduce fertilization in fall and winter when growth slows down.
